https://preview.redd.it/ee2eyz69xc8d1.jpeg?width=3024&format=pjpg&auto=webp&s=9b23e9c7f15936b52c3d254522c85f908ccbe486 Just found this at my late uncles can someone let me know
Submariner would not have a GMT bezel. Also the crown, hands, dial, date font, etc are all wrong for a Rolex
Old fake, sorry
How could u tell, I’m just curious
Date is an easy tell. Plus it looks like a GMT bezel but it's a "Submariner"

https://preview.redd.it/eipimsktyr7d1.jpeg?width=828&format=pjpg&auto=webp&s=a152ffee8994a89ae64af87e531bdb62bd2a7cbd Saw at an estate sale today. Judging from the rest of the sale i doubt this older gentleman would’ve had any fakes but wanted some opinions
That's an old fake. Back in the day fake Rolexes were basically like gag gifts, so if anything well-off people were more likely to have well-traveled friends who bought them a $5 "Rolex" in Vietnam in 1989 because they thought it was funny. It wasn't a serious thing back then.
